+// The calling convention for JSFunctions on X87 passes arguments on the
+// stack and the JSFunction and context in EDI and ESI, respectively, thus
+// the steps of the call look as follows:
+
+// --{ before the call instruction }--------------------------------------------
+//                                                         |  caller frame |
+//                                                         ^ esp           ^ ebp
+
+// --{ push arguments and setup ESI, EDI }--------------------------------------
+//                                       |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+//                                       ^ esp                             ^ ebp
+//                 [edi = JSFunction, esi = context]
+
+// --{ call [edi + kCodeEntryOffset] }------------------------------------------
+//                                 | RET |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+//                                 ^ esp                                   ^ ebp
+
+// =={ prologue of called function }============================================
+// --{ push ebp }---------------------------------------------------------------
+//                            | FP | RET |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+//                            ^ esp                                        ^ ebp
+
+// --{ mov ebp, esp }-----------------------------------------------------------
+//                            | FP | RET |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+//                            ^ ebp,esp
+
+// --{ push esi }---------------------------------------------------------------
+//                      | CTX | FP | RET |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+//                      ^esp  ^ ebp
+
+// --{ push edi }---------------------------------------------------------------
+//                | FNC | CTX | FP | RET |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+//                ^esp        ^ ebp
+
+// --{ subi esp, #N }-----------------------------------------------------------
+// | callee frame | FNC | CTX | FP | RET |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+// ^esp                       ^ ebp
+
+// =={ body of called function }================================================
+
+// =={ epilogue of called function }============================================
+// --{ mov esp, ebp }-----------------------------------------------------------
+//                            | FP | RET |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+//                            ^ esp,ebp
+
+// --{ pop ebp }-----------------------------------------------------------
+// |                               | RET |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+//                                 ^ esp                                   ^ ebp
+
+// --{ ret #A+1 }-----------------------------------------------------------
+// |                                                       |  caller frame |
+//                                                         ^ esp           ^ ebp
+
+
+// Runtime function calls are accomplished by doing a stub call to the
+// CEntryStub (a real code object). On X87 passes arguments on the
+// stack, the number of arguments in EAX, the address of the runtime function
+// in EBX, and the context in ESI.
+
+// --{ before the call instruction }--------------------------------------------
+//                                                         |  caller frame |
+//                                                         ^ esp           ^ ebp
+
+// --{ push arguments and setup EAX, EBX, and ESI }-----------------------------
+//                                       |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+//                                       ^ esp                             ^ ebp
+//              [eax = #args, ebx = runtime function, esi = context]
+
+// --{ call #CEntryStub }-------------------------------------------------------
+//                                 | RET | args + receiver |  caller frame |
+//                                 ^ esp                                   ^ ebp
+
+// =={ body of runtime function }===============================================
+
+// --{ runtime returns }--------------------------------------------------------
+//                                                         |  caller frame |
+//                                                         ^ esp           ^ ebp
+
+// Other custom linkages (e.g. for calling directly into and out of C++) may
+// need to save callee-saved registers on the stack, which is done in the
+// function prologue of generated code.
+
+// --{ before the call instruction }--------------------------------------------
+//                                                         |  caller frame |
+//                                                         ^ esp           ^ ebp
+
+// --{ set up arguments in registers on stack }---------------------------------
+//                                                  | args |  caller frame |
+//                                                  ^ esp                  ^ ebp
+//                  [r0 = arg0, r1 = arg1, ...]
+
+// --{ call code }--------------------------------------------------------------
+//                                            | RET | args |  caller frame |
+//                                            ^ esp                        ^ ebp
+
+// =={ prologue of called function }============================================
+// --{ push ebp }---------------------------------------------------------------
+//                                       | FP | RET | args |  caller frame |
+//                                       ^ esp                             ^ ebp
+
+// --{ mov ebp, esp }-----------------------------------------------------------
+//                                       | FP | RET | args |  caller frame |
+//                                       ^ ebp,esp
+
+// --{ save registers }---------------------------------------------------------
+//                                | regs | FP | RET | args |  caller frame |
+//                                ^ esp  ^ ebp
+
+// --{ subi esp, #N }-----------------------------------------------------------
+//                 | callee frame | regs | FP | RET | args |  caller frame |
+//                 ^esp                  ^ ebp
+
+// =={ body of called function }================================================
+
+// =={ epilogue of called function }============================================
+// --{ restore registers }------------------------------------------------------
+//                                | regs | FP | RET | args |  caller frame |
+//                                ^ esp  ^ ebp
+
+// --{ mov esp, ebp }-----------------------------------------------------------
+//                                       | FP | RET | args |  caller frame |
+//                                       ^ esp,ebp
+
+// --{ pop ebp }----------------------------------------------------------------
+//                                            | RET | args |  caller frame |
+//                                            ^ esp                        ^ ebp
+
